Bucky Lab AMC - Elevator pitch

After 4 weeks of intensive work on the concepts we had the elevator pitch today. With 62 concepts it was a firework of ideas and not only our own experts but also Onno Valk from the AMC was impressed about the diversity of the ideas the students presented.

The range of ideas was quite broad from smaller inventions to get more daylight into the depths of the building towards more architectural concepts for the entire facade. (We will publish the concepts later this week in detail.)

After a short break we decided to have all concepts presented before the lunch and afterwards we were able to start the group finding session. This is the moment the students have to decide by themselves which ideas and concept have the biggest potential to be further developed.
